There are three main sources that allow lead to leach into drinking water: lead service lines, lead solder, and water faucets made from brass alloys containing lead. In the 1930s Joliet, along with many other communities around the country, banned the use of lead for service lines. At that time, Joliet began to require copper water service lines for all new construction. In addition to the cost-sharing program, the City of Joliet is also utilizing the IEPA Low Interest Loan Program with principal forgiveness to complete projects in parts of the City where there are concentrated locations of known lead service lines.
